Question
my friend pet staffers bull terrier which is 3 years old has taken to chasing its tail ,sometimes catches it and chews it a little.the area which it chews looks raw we would like some advice on how to prevent this and what are the causes for this behavior

Answer
Hi Danny;
I would think it is either compulsive behavior, which is like compulsive behavior in humans. Tranquilizers or anti-depressants are usually prescribed by Veterinarians, and I think animal massage along with the meds until the massages have time to relax the dog and ease any fears that are causing this.

The other couse could be allergies.
Due to the chewing until the area is raw.
Does the dog chew it's ffet are any other area?
Allergies are quite common with dogs. We have messed with our enviornment until humans and animals have more allergies than are allergy free.
Either situation will require a Vterinarian's exam, possibly tests, and diagnosis, then prescribed treatments.
With either situation, if not treated, it wil only get worse.
